The usage of emoji’s, gifs, and abbreviations within a company email or an email sent to a professional audience can be controversial as some people may feel they are unprofessional while others might see them as a useful way to communicate quickly. While it is ultimately up to the individual user to decide if such methods are appropriate in this context there are certain risks that should be taken into consideration prior sending out any emails containing these types of elements.

Emoji’s have become increasingly popular in recent years as they allow writers convey complex emotions with minimal effort; although this can help inject personality into conversation it also leaves room for misinterpretation since same icon could mean something entirely different depending on how receiver interprets its meaning (Tuttle). Similarly, GIFs offer great potential when used correctly because they provide readers with visual representation ideas however unintended messages still remain possible if wrong file chosen thus caution must taken whenever inserting them into emails (Hendrickson). Finally, abbreviations like “LOL” or “FYI” can come off rude if not utilized carefully; even though many phrases have been adopted by mainstream culture those unfamiliar with their true definitions may take offense thus jeopardizing relationships between colleagues (Jordan).

In conclusion, deciding whether one should include emoji’s gifs or acronyms when communicating via email will depend heavily on particular situation; this decision needs made after considering all possible risks involved thoroughly so writer does not appear unprofessional inadvertently through their words.
